GOSPEL | Luke 8:1-3
Jesus journeyed from one town and village to another,
preaching and proclaiming the good news of the Kingdom of God.
Accompanying him were the Twelve
and some women who had been cured of evil spirits and infirmities,
Mary, called Magdalene, from whom seven demons had gone out,
Joanna, the wife of Herod's steward Chuza,
Susanna, and many others
who provided for them out of their resources.

GOING DEEPER
Walking with Jesus, Giving for His Kingdom
This passage is short, but it is powerful. It reminds us that the mission of Jesus was not a solo act. He traveled from town to town, proclaiming the Kingdom, surrounded not just by the Twelve apostles, but also by faithful women whose lives He had transformed. Mary Magdalene, once tormented by seven demons, now walked in freedom. Joanna, from a household tied to Herod’s court, risked reputation and security to follow. Susanna and others gave of their resources, sustaining the work of Christ.
For first-century Jews, this scene would have been shocking. Rabbis did not gather women as disciples. Yet Jesus honors their dignity, welcomes their presence, and includes their contributions in the unfolding story of salvation. The Kingdom advances not only through preachers, but through those who walk, serve, and give.
The Gospel makes it clear: discipleship is not passive. It costs something. These women gave materially out of gratitude, because Jesus had given them new life. They didn’t just admire Him—they invested in Him. Their resources became part of the Kingdom’s expansion. And their names are forever remembered in Scripture.
